    IBFX Crowned Best Online FX Provider in MoneyAM 2008 Online Finance Awards -Business's unique multi-bank order routing system also recognized as runner-up in Best Active Trading Platform egory-
    SALT LAKE CITY --(BUSINESS WIRE)--In the half-way point of a year marked with numerous industry accolades, Interbank FX ( http://www.ibfx.com/), a global provider of online foreign currency (Forex/FX) trading , today announced that it achieved high ranking in the MoneyAM Online Finance Awards in the ”Best Online FX Provider” egory and has been recognized as runner-up for ” Best Active Trading Platform,” which recognized the organization's unique multi-bank order router and implementation system.

    All the year's award winners were chosen by consumers of MoneyAM--an online Website for its sister publiion, Shares magazine, and a few of the premier destinations for personal investors in the UK --who voted for their favourite suppliers in several egories, including Best Online Futures Provider, Best Online Funds Service and Best Online US Market Trading Service. Other quality contenders in this year's event comprised GFT, Saxo Bank and Interactive Brokers.

    ”We're delighted to receive this honour that admits IBFX as a true industry leader, also thank the many customers of MoneyAM to their gracious support,” said Todd Crosland, Chairman and President of Interbank FX. ”The fact that these awards have been voted for by actual traders who find value in our company only strengthens our commnt to supply our clients state-of-the art trading capabilities and continual product improvement.”

    IBFX has achieved several company milestones in 2008 year-to-date, also has undergone rapid growth in client accounts and trading volume over this time period. The company continues to distinguish itself as a top foreign exchange trading platform, using its unique ”no coping desk”, multi-bank implementation technologies.
    Among the many accomplishments that demone IBFX's continued value proposition to clients comprise: Strong Growth in Client Accounts: Current customer base in excess of 26,000 active accounts in 140 nations around the globe Record Trading Volumes: Notional one-day trading volume of over $11 billion on June 30, 2008 signifies the highest daily trading volume recorded in IBFX's history of performance. Earnings Growth: YTD revenues more than 140 percent compared to same period
    This most recent celebrity by MoneyAM follows hot on the heels of IBFX's success in the 2008 American Business Awards--hailed as ”the business world's version of the Oscars”--where the company was recognized as a Finalist in three separate groups, including Best Chairman (Todd Crosland), Best Marketing Executive (Marilyn McDonald) and Best New Product or Service (https://secure.ibfx.com/Ibfxu/Default.aspx).

    Interbank FX was also named Best Foreign Exchange Broker in the 2007 Shares Awards in London.

    Concerning Interbank FX / IBFX.com

    Interbank FX ( http://www.ibfx.com/) is a Futures Commission Merchant (FCM), registered with the Commodity Futures Trading Commission and a member of the National Futures Association (NFA). With clients in over 135 countries throughout the globe, IBFX provides individual traders, fund managers and institutional clients proprietary technology and a revolutionary way of Forex trading. IBFX clients execute directly from a streaming quote feed, instead of from a working desk that trades against its clients, and provides one of the only automated trading platforms on the planet. Customers can program their own algorithms that will automatically enter and exit trades according to their trading egy. IBFX Wireless provides clients the flexibility to monitor, modify, execute trades and receive alerts anywhere in the world. Through partnerships with major global institutions, IBFX traders have access to liquidity from 1,000 to 5 million of the base currency with a single click execution. Customers can exchange micro, mini and regular lots. IBFX is committed to maintaining a high level of service that enables clients to focus on trading opportunities in the Forex market while limiting their margin and liquidity risks. Trading at the off-exchange retail foreign currency market is one of the riskiest forms of investment and should only be attempted by experienced traders.
